Important commentary from CAPRS co-founder and co-director Rez Gardi has been highlighted by the New Zealand Herald, where she addressed the UK government’s proposed new “tough measures” aimed at preventing people from seeking asylum.

She cautioned that restricting access to asylum does not deter people from moving, stating: “What we’ve seen over many years is that stopping people from accessing safety or accessing borders to seek asylum does not stop people from moving…It just means that they end up in more dangerous routes, or taking more dangerous risks to try to seek safety. It doesn’t stop people from trying, it just means that more people die in their attempt.”
